These are Brooks stats. Not historically a great 3pt shooter. (Which is what the Kings are hoping would return no doubt.) Decent in that Brooks is a 36% career 3pt shooter (he regressed in a big way his last season in Houston and Phoenix). Which means what? I’m hoping that regression doesn’t continue, but not hopeful.

The good news is that if Brooks doesn’t work, it means that the Kings won’t have to pay him much beyond next season. But, yikes! If it does work? Well, okay. I’m not opposed to that. But as of right now, with 7 G’s, yes count them, 7 Guards on the roster (Evans, Thomas, Salmons, Thornton, Garcia, Brooks and Fredete), that’s a bit much yes?
